2. Traditions Renewed: Customs and Rituals Surrounding Eid ul Fitr 2024 in Pakistan

Eid ul Fitr 2024 in Pakistan is marked by a rich tapestry of customs and rituals passed down through generations. The day begins with the performance of Eid prayers, where Muslims gather in mosques or open fields to offer thanks to the Almighty for the strength and blessings received during Ramadan. Following the prayers, families exchange warm embraces and heartfelt Eid greetings, spreading joy and goodwill.

3. Community Spirit: Unity and Generosity During Eid ul Fitr Festivities

One of the most beautiful aspects of Eid ul Fitr in Pakistan is the spirit of unity and generosity that pervades the festivities. It is a time when the divides of class, status, and wealth are set aside as people come together to celebrate their shared faith and humanity. Charitable acts, such as giving alms to the less fortunate (known as Zakat al-Fitr), are encouraged, ensuring that everyone can partake in the joy of the occasion.

5. Festive Feasts: Culinary Delights and Specialties of Eid ul Fitr 2024

No celebration in Pakistan is complete without an abundance of delicious food, and Eid ul Fitr 2024 is no exception. Families gather to enjoy lavish feasts featuring various traditional dishes and specialities, including savoury biryanis, aromatic kebabs, and sweet treats like sheer khurma and gulab jamun. The aroma of spices fills the air as kitchens come alive with the sounds of sizzling pans and bubbling pots, creating an unforgettable culinary experience for all.
